Taken from a pair of sessions taped during 19551956, lady sings the blues finds holiday in top form and backed by the sympathetic likes of tenor saxophonist paul quinichette, trumpeters charlie shavers and harry edison, pianist wynton kelly, and guitarists kenny burrell and barney kessel. Beginning with holidays traumatic youth, the film depicts her early attempts at a singing career and her eventual rise to stardom, as well as her difficult relationship with louis mckay billy dee williams, her boyfriend and manager.
